Fort Knox is an open pit gold mine and is owned and operated by Kinross. The mine has a capacity of 92Mt/a. Higher grade ore is treated by conventional mill whilst lower grade material is crushed and then stacked on heap leach pads. The gold solution from the mill and heap leach pads is further treated in a carbon plant to recover a gold/silver doré. The mill has a capacity of up to 45ktpd. Large volumes of lower-grade ore and mineralized waste materials are processed via heap leaching.
